package freemarker.template.instruction;
import java.io.IOException;
import java.io.InvalidObjectException;
import java.io.ObjectInputStream;
import java.io.Serializable;
import java.io.Writer;
import freemarker.template.TemplateException;
import freemarker.template.TemplateProcessor;
import freemarker.template.TemplateRuntimeHandler;
import freemarker.template.TemplateWriteableHashModel;
import freemarker.template.expression.Expression;
import freemarker.template.expression.Identifier;
import freemarker.template.expression.Variable;
/**
* An instruction that assigns a literal or reference to a single-identifier
* variable.
*
* @version $Id: AssignInstruction.java 1123 2005-10-04 10:48:25Z run2000 $
*/
public final class AssignInstruction extends EmptyInstruction implements Serializable {
/**
* @serial the variable to which the value will be assigned
*/
private final Variable variable;
/**
* @serial an expression which, when evaluated, will be assigned to the
* variable
*/
private final Expression value;
/** Serialization UUID for this class. */
private static final long serialVersionUID = 6116263906768944170L;
/**
* Constructor that takes a vairable to be assigned and the expression whose
* value should be assigned.
*
* @param variable
* the variable to assign to.
* @param value
* the expression to assign.
* @throws NullPointerException
* the variable or value is null
* @throws IllegalArgumentException
* attempt to assign variable to an iterator
*/
public AssignInstruction(Variable variable, Expression value) {
if (variable == null) {
throw new NullPointerException("Variable in assign instruction cannot be null");
}
if (value == null) {
throw new NullPointerException("Value expression in assign instruction cannot be null");
}
// This test is non-obvious, but the idea here is to avoid breaking the
// ability to recycle iterators back to their list parent objects. The
// releaseIterator method assumes we can't create a reference to the
// iterator that can escape the current <list> or <foreach>
// instruction. Of course there are other ways of getting around this
// requirement, but are non-obvious and require intentionally breaking
// the model. <assign> statements look more innocent.
if (value instanceof Identifier) {
String name = ((Identifier) value).getName();
if (name.endsWith("#")) {
throw new IllegalArgumentException("Cannot assign variable to transient iterator variable");
}
}
this.variable = variable;
this.value = value;
}
/**
* Process this <code><assign ... ></code> instruction.
*
* @param modelRoot
* the root node of the data model
* @param out
* a <code>Writer</code> to send the output to
* @param eventHandler
* a <code>TemplateEventAdapter</code> for handling any events
* that occur during processing
*/
public short process(TemplateWriteableHashModel modelRoot, Writer out, TemplateRuntimeHandler eventHandler) throws IOException {
try {
variable.setTemplateModel(modelRoot, value.getAsTemplateModel(modelRoot));
} catch (TemplateException e) {
eventHandler.fireExceptionThrown(this, new TemplateException("Couldn't perform assignment", e), out, "freemarker.template.instruction.AssignInstruction.process",
TemplateRuntimeHandler.SEVERITY_WARNING);
}
return TemplateProcessor.OK;
}
/**
* Returns a string representation of the object.
*
* @return a <code>String</code> representing this instruction subtree
*/
public String toString() {
StringBuffer buffer = new StringBuffer();
buffer.append("assign ");
buffer.append(variable);
buffer.append(" to ");
buffer.append(value);
return buffer.toString();
}
/**
* For serialization, read this object normally, then check whether both
* sides of the statement are non-null.
*
* @param stream
* the input stream to read serialized objects from
*/
private void readObject(ObjectInputStream stream) throws IOException, ClassNotFoundException {
stream.defaultReadObject();
if ((variable == null) || (value == null)) {
throw new InvalidObjectException("Cannot create an AssignInstruction with a null variable or value");
}
}
}
